From Tokyo to Osaka: PSI Continues Japan Expansion with New Office in Osaka
Osaka, Japan, 14th January 2026 / Sciad Communications / PSI CRO, a Swiss-based global full-service contract research organization, today announced further expansion in Japan, with the opening of the second office located on Level 18 of the Hilton Plaza West Office Tower in Umeda, Kita-ku, Osaka.
Japan is a vital market for pivotal clinical trials. In early 2025, PSI opened its first Japanese office in Tokyo and appointed Sayaka Kaji as Country Manager for Japan. By adding an Osaka location, PSI brings sponsors closer to experienced local teams and the local PSI team closer to the established site networks.

PSI’s further expansion and continued growth in Japan follows recent office expansions in Asia-Pacific, including South Korea, Singapore, China, Taiwan, India, Australia, and New Zealand, where PSI operates with dedicated full-time office-based staff.
